Remove the constraint for concrete specs and simply take the
max(version) if a version is not given. This should default to the
highest infinity version which is also the logical best guess for
doing development.

Remove the `build-tools` tag of python, otherwise these types of
concretizations are possible:
```
py-root
^py-pip
^python@3.12
^python@3.13
```
So, a package would be configured with py-pip using python 3.12, but
installed for 3.13, which does not work.

The CMake builder in Spack actually adds incorrect rpaths. They are
unfiltered and incorrectly ordered compared to what the compiler wrapper
adds.
There is no need to specify paths to dependencies in `CMAKE_INSTALL_RPATH`
because of two reasons:
1. CMake preserves "toolchain" rpaths, which includes the rpaths injected
by our compiler wrapper.
2. We use `CMAKE_INSTALL_RPATH_USE_LINK_PATH=ON`, so libraries we link
to are rpath'ed automatically.
However, CMake does not create install rpaths to directories in the package's
own install prefix, so we set `CMAKE_INSTALL_RPATH` to the educated guess
`<prefix>/{lib,lib64}`, but omit dependencies.
